The crypto market has long been a Wild West of speculation, but Evolve Funds is betting on institutional rigor to tame volatility and capture overlooked value in blockchain infrastructure. On June 18, 2025, the launch of its XRP ETF (XRP/XRP.U) and its inclusion in the Evolve Cryptocurrencies ETF (ETC) marks a pivotal moment for Canadian investors seeking to capitalize on underappreciated digital assets while adhering to regulatory clarity.

XRP, the cryptocurrency behind Ripple's cross-border payment system, has long been overshadowed by Bitcoin's dominance. Yet its utility as a fast, low-cost settlement tool for banks and remittance providers remains its secret weapon. Evolve's ETF allows investors to gain direct exposure to XRP—without owning the asset outright—through two share classes: CAD unhedged units (XRP) and USD units (XRP.U).
The ETF's 0.75% management fee—reduced from an initial 1%—is a competitive edge in a space where many crypto funds charge over 1.5%. This cost efficiency, paired with institutional-grade custody (secured via platforms like
and OTC counterparties), positions the fund to attract both retail and institutional investors weary of high fees and security risks.The inclusion of XRP in the Evolve Cryptocurrencies ETF (ETC) transforms it into a well-rounded crypto portfolio. ETC now holds Bitcoin, Ethereum, Solana, and XRP, weighted by market cap and rebalanced monthly. This diversification is critical in a market where single-asset exposure can amplify volatility.
XRP's addition isn't just about balancing risk—it's about betting on blockchain infrastructure plays. While Bitcoin and Ethereum dominate headlines, XRP's focus on institutional adoption (e.g., partnerships with
and MoneyGram) offers a distinct value proposition.The XRP ETF's most underrated advantage lies in its use of the CME CF XRP-Dollar Reference Rate (XRPUSD_RR), administered by CF Benchmarks. This regulated, once-daily benchmark—recognized under UK and EU frameworks—ensures transparent pricing for the ETF's NAV calculations. For institutional investors, this is a game-changer: it avoids the wild swings of unregulated exchanges and aligns with global standards for benchmarks.
